Which mineral is commonly used in the production of glass?
-
Sand
-
Soda Ash
-
Limestone
-
Bauxite
A
Correct answer
Explanation
Sand is commonly used in the production of glass. It is composed primarily of silica and is a key ingredient in the manufacturing of various types of glass.
Which mineral is commonly used in the construction of bridges and buildings?
-
Granite
-
Sandstone
-
Limestone
-
Marble
A
Correct answer
Explanation
Granite is commonly used in the construction of bridges and buildings. It is an igneous rock composed of quartz, feldspar, and mica, and is known for its strength and durability.
